#66863f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#66863f is composed of 40% red, 52.5% green and 24.7%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 23.9% cyan, 0% magenta, 53% yellow and 47.5% black. It has a hue angle of 87 degrees, a saturation of 36% and a lightness of 38.6%. #66863f color hex could be obtained by blending #ccff7e with #000d00. Closest websafe color is: #669933.

#66863f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#66863f has RGB values of R:102, G:134, B:63 and CMYK values of C:0.24, M:0, Y:0.53, K:0.47. Its decimal value is 6719039.
